Output ceb7ac8146fa22d5721e51fe49862675eba4222dfc36d9e78d43d72eb2cb6e1c:1

value
3596250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fbebeaf010c180040108ec3033b48bf679b7ba4 OP_EQUAL
address
MCFcVdZtxkR94wDcd88mn4EGAbNHxxJxoL
transaction
ceb7ac8146fa22d5721e51fe49862675eba4222dfc36d9e78d43d72eb2cb6e1c
spent
true